英文摘要 | Vanadium dioxide (VO2) is an ideal thermochromic material for "smart window" which can reduce energy consumption of air conditioning in modern architectures. However, the application of VO2-based smart window is always limited by the poor luminous transmittance (T-lum), low solar regulation efficiency (Delta T-sol) and unsightly brown color. According to previous researches, compositing has been approved to be an effective method to solve all of above issues for VO2-based smart window simultaneously. In this work, a new thermochromic ionic liquid (nickel-bromine-ionic liquid (or Ni-Br-IL, for short)) was synthesized and introduced to be composited with VO2 nanoparticles for enhanced performance. The composite film demonstrates ultrahigh optical properties: Delta T-sol = 27.0%, which is 1.91 times higher than that of pure VO2 film (14.1%) at a rather high T-lum (T-l,T-lum = 65.9% and T-h,T-lum = 55.3%) with little loss of visible light at high temperature (Delta T-lum = 10.6%). Meanwhile, it can be observed the color change from light yellow to green clearly as the temperature rises. Such enhanced performance will benefit the publicity and application for VO2-based smart window. |
